Ellipses are important curves used in the mathematical sciences.The trammel of Archimedes is an example of a four-bar linkage with two sliders and two pivots, and is special case of the more general oblique trammel. The axes constraining the pivots do not have to be perpendicular and the points A, B and C can form a triangle. The resulting locus of C is still an ellipse. I had to add grid and element snapping for sliding connectors in the latest (not yet available) Linkage program.Jul 30, 2015 · The envelope of the moving bar of the Trammel of Archimedes, is the astroid. An astroid is a particular mathematical curve: a hypocycloid with four cusps. The astroid is a real locus of a plane algebraic curve of genus zero. The curve has a variety of names, including tetracuspid, cubocycloid, and paracycle.

A trammel of Archimedes is a mechanism that generates the shape of an ellipse. [1] It consists of two shuttles which are confined ("trammeled") to perpendicular channels or rails and a rod which is attached to the shuttles by pivots at fixed positions along the rod.
